Ian SpiridigliozziIan Spiridigliozzi
This place is consistent but I sometimes feel like the staff could just be more experienced or trained better overall. I do think they're all really sweet and well intentioned employees though and they want to do well; but for example, 3 people at a table usually means 3 settings and 3 menus. We ended up getting our own setting after food had already been served. It's a small thing overall, but it can add up, I'm sure; especially if they're busy. The atmosphere gets a three because of this place isn't busy, it's a very large sort of empty feeling establishment. Long empty tables, etc. Then again, I choose a Sunday night so what exactly was I expecting. The place is clean. The popcorn they offer the tables is a nice touch but SO salty and (possibly because it's dinner when I went) maybe less than freshly popped. You really should come for the wings which are delicious, crispy, and perfectly cooked every time. If you think of this place as a sports bar, I think you're on the right track. Pretty good beer selection. I think a bartender with better cocktail offerings could really breathe life into this place, but that's just me. All gender restrooms are a plus. All in all, if you want the wings, you're coming regardless and it's a good time.

This spot is an amazing vibe on Austin St. I stumbled upon it with a friend of mine and I was not disappointed. They serve you a bowl of yummy complimentary popcorn while you wait for your food, how cute! I have to say the BURST of flavors are devine. I got the Crispy chicken bowl - the Korean noodles were incredible. The mix of guacamole and bbq had me nervous at first, but once I took a bite it was actually really good. I love how creative the food is there. We also got the kimchi fries which I forgot to take a photo off because we literally stuffed our faces as soon as it came out. It was FIRE! It def has a kick so warning if you don’t like spicy. They have excellent kids options as well, my daughter loved their chicken bowl. I can’t wait to come back to Forest Hills and eat here again!
